Stablecoins are rapidly transforming the landscape of global finance, moving far beyond their initial role as simple on-ramps for cryptocurrency trading. A recent analysis by Ripple executive Reece Merrick underscores a dramatic surge in demand, particularly for the RLUSD stablecoin, driven by its burgeoning utility in real-world payments and cross-border remittances. This shift highlights a fundamental evolution in how digital assets are integrated into the global economy, challenging traditional payment systems with unprecedented growth.

The Expanding Realm of Stablecoin Utility

The primary catalyst for this increased demand is the dramatic expansion of stablecoin applications. Initially conceived as a straightforward method to acquire other cryptocurrencies, stablecoins have evolved to become a critical layer for actual payments. Merrick's data illustrates this profound change, showing on-chain stablecoin transfers skyrocketing from approximately $0.5 trillion in 2020 to an estimated $46 trillion by 2025. This projected volume for 2025 is set to surpass the combined settled volumes of traditional payment giants like Visa and Mastercard from the previous year. This phenomenal growth, maintaining an annual rate of about 150%, signifies stablecoins' increasing adoption for business-to-business (B2B) settlements, merchant transactions, and efficient cross-border remittances, establishing them as a new, dynamic payment infrastructure for the internet.

RLUSD's Ascendance in the Digital Economy

Amidst this broader stablecoin surge, RLUSD is experiencing significant traction. Less than a year since its launch, the stablecoin has already exceeded $1 billion in market capitalization on the Ethereum blockchain, a clear indicator of its growing adoption. Its integration into the Decentralized Finance (DeFi) ecosystem on the XRP Ledger further amplifies its visibility and utility. The robust demand for RLUSD has led to its listing on multiple global exchanges. Looking ahead, regulatory frameworks such as the GENIUS Act in the United States, coupled with Ripple's strategic push for tokenization, are expected to further solidify RLUSD's position and expand its global reach, cementing its role in the future of digital payments.
